Main altarpiece of the miraflores charterhouse (burgos). Isabella the catholic. It was isabel the catholic who commissioned this altarpiece from gil de silóe to commemorate her parents, juan ii and isabel of portugal, buried in the head of the church. There is no doubt that the queen also wanted to be represented in such a magnificent work, along with her husband fernando, kneeling and dressed in their best clothes, presented by their titular saints. The two figures are in profile, crowned and with gloved hands, another example of the good work of silóe and his collaborator in the painting, diego de la cruz.
